Pronunciation: ' le-v ē ; l ə - ' v ē , - ' v ā
Function: noun
Etymology: French lever, from Middle French, act of arising, from ( se ) lever to rise
Date: 1672
1 : a reception held by a person of distinction on rising from bed
2 : an afternoon assembly at which the British sovereign or his or her representative receives only men
3 : a reception usually in honor of a particular person
